It's a bit late notice but a new Drift venue very similar to Santa Pod has been announced that will be held at Donnington on Saturday the 29th May. It has better surfaces and is bigger than the pod layout so it gives you much more seat time plus it is a tenner cheaper at £50 for the day. There is also a tyre man (mint tyres) on site as well just like the pod with similar tyre prices I believe?
